Technological progress is bottlenecked by the fact that there are many mathematical problems for which currently there are no known practical methods of solution.

Because even with supercomputers the equations that describe many physical systems cannot be solved, research and development is still based on a lot of empirical methods, i.e. things must be physically built and measured, because mathematical computations cannot predict their properties with sufficient accuracy.

So if some miraculous algorithms would be discovered for the approximate solution of the systems of equations that are insoluble for now, that could accelerate technological progress a lot in certain domains, especially for the discovery of new materials or chemical substances with desirable properties.
